Sharon
Skowronski
received her B.A. (major field English) from The Cleveland State University in
1975. She began her CWRU employment
in June of that year as an Administrative Secretary in the English Department.
She transferred to Political Science in January 1977, was promoted to
Department Assistant I, and was further promoted to Department Assistant II when
she took on administrative duties for additional departments
― Religion and
Philosophy (October 1983-January 1985); Classics (January 1985-July 1985);
Classics and Religion (July 1985-present); continuing her services to Political
Science throughout. She is
now Department Assistant III. Her
educational background was utilized when she served as a contributor and
Assistant Editor to Political Parties of Europe, 2 vols., The
Greenwood Historical Encyclopedia of the World's Political Parties
(Westport, Conn.: Greenwood Press, 1983; also London: Aldwych Press, 1983),
Vincent E. McHale, editor-in-chief. Over
the years Sharon has added computer applications to her repertoire of
administrative skills and now spends nearly all of her office time in front of a
computer -- when not busy answering the usual multitude of questions from
faculty and students. In the past
Sharon has been nominated for the President's Award for Distinguished Service.
